Transaction 2911101662e1e1c8e619f9467aa9bf54c0b5e5a00eb83a52177c51dc87cd5201
1 Input
1 Output
-
2911101662e1e1c8e619f9467aa9bf54c0b5e5a00eb83a52177c51dc87cd5201:0
- value
- 44289
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ee2e46b84e07a4ff24cc86cb806c1e36dbd6c01de709329b2f8f1f80ffcf8e98
- address
- bc1pachydwzwq7j07fxvsm9cqmq7xmdadsqauuyn9xe03u0cpl7036vqclmxgr